Czech Senate recognizes Holodomor as genocide against Ukrainian people

President of Ukraine Volodymyr Zelensky has welcomed the decision of the Senate of the Czech Republic to recognize the Holodomor of 1932-1933 as genocide against the Ukrainian people.

The head of the Ukrainian state wrote this on Twitter, Ukrinform reports.

“I welcome the decision of the Senate of the Czech Republic to recognize the Holodomor as genocide against the Ukrainian people. I am grateful to my Czech friends for establishing the truth and restoring historical justice. Punishment for all past and present crimes of Russia is inevitable,” Zelensky wrote.

As reported by Ukrinform, Ukraine calls on the world to recognize the 1932-1933 Holodomor organized by Stalin’s totalitarian communist regime as genocide againt the Ukrainian people.
